In 1932, Barnett was appointed an Assistant Keeper in the Department of Egyptian and Assyrian Antiquities at the British Museum. He remained in that office until 1939, when he moved to the Admiralty for war service; after spells there and at the Foreign Office, he served in the RAF from 1942 to 1946.

On demobilisation, he returned to his post at the British Museum in 1946 and was promoted to Deputy Keeper in 1953. In 1955, he became Keeper of the department, serving until 1974. He then spent the 1974-75 year as a visiting professor at the Hebrew University of Jerusalem.
